Dow Jones Drops 300 Points as Oil Prices Climb Amid U.S.-Iran Tensions

The Dow Jones Industrial Average fell by 300 points as traders took a moment to reassess after a recent market rally. Meanwhile, rising oil prices are drawing attention amid ongoing tensions related to the U.S.-Iran conflict. These developments are significant for global markets as fluctuations in oil prices could influence inflation and consumer spending. If the conflict escalates, further volatility in both equity and commodities markets is likely.
